The seedling contests continue and the interest in growing seedlings continues as well, there having been a call during the past year from this office for a considerable number of packages of apple seeds by our membership.
So far no apple seedling has appeared to which we could award the $1,000 prize offered by the society for a winter apple. Referring to the seedling contest inaugurated some years ago, the first $100 premium in connection with which should have been awarded three years ago, it appears that the time limit for the fruitage of these seedlings was made too short. The fourth premium comes due at this meeting, but no claimants have as yet come forward for any of these premiums. Probably it will be thought a wise thing to do to continue these awards during later years when these seedling trees will come into bearing.
The "acre orchard" contest entered into a year ago last spring in which there 35 entries finally materialized into a smaller number than anticipated, reports having come into the office last year from 23 contestants. The reports for the current year are now being received but not all at hand.
The executive board provided conditions under which these orchards should be conducted and the prizes awarded, which conditions will be found published in the 1914 report of the society on page 45.
Trial stations are continuing their work and are being used principally now as far as new material is concerned in testing of fruits from the State Fruit-Breeding Farm. To this list has been added the government station at Mandan under the management of A. W. Peterson, reports from which point will also be made to our association from time to time, as well as from the trial stations connected with University Farm, all of which stations have been added also to our society list.
Arrangements are being perfected for the purpose of extending to our membership opportunity to use the books from the society library, which is now increased to about 3,300 volumes. This list has been published in the 1915 report of the society, and we shall be prepared early in the year to send out books to all who desire them according to the regulations, which will be published in an early number of our monthly.
The society is maintaining its card indexes and adding year by year to the amount of material which they represent. One of these cards indexes contains the names and titles of all the articles published in the society's annual reports and is indexed also with the names of the writers, the index being prepared in this double manner. Another card index contains the list of books in our library, and the third one, indexed by subjects, the bulletins on horticulture coming from the various state experiment stations and the U.S. Department of Agriculture. These indexes are invaluable for their various purposes and may be used by the membership at their volition.
The society maintained an office at the late state fair, at which a considerable number of memberships were received and a large number of members met by the secretary and other officers of the society. We believe this was an excellent move and should be continued in the future.
As to the horticultural exhibit at the state fair, while the secretary has no official connection with it, it should be spoken of as a very satisfactory exhibition indeed and well handled. The building as a whole, covering all branches of horticultural work, was a real credit to the various interests represented and well deserves all the time and expense lavished upon it.
Probably the most important event of the year with which the secretary was officially connected was the effort made to secure an appropriation from the state legislature in session last winter for the construction of a building for the uses of the Horticultural Society. The building committee, with which the secretary served, held a number of meetings with members of the Board of Regents and various committees at the state legislature, at which a considerable number of our membership besides those regularly on the committee were in attendance and took part in appeals in the interest of the building. The secretary's service in this connection was largely the effort made to enlist the co-operation of the membership in the way of getting them to write letters or talk personally with the members of the legislature upon the subject, and an appeal was sent out through the mails to all of our membership with this object in view. The response was a most liberal one, far beyond our expectations. Some of the members of the legislature received over thirty letters from their constituents asking their support to this measure. There was not a single member of the legislature who did not receive some communications about this matter. In all there were sent in this manner to members of the legislature 1,594 letters. While our efforts to secure this building failed, it was, as we believe, largely on account of the prevailing and unusual sentiment for economy which permeated the legislature to an extraordinary degree, and we have reasonable assurance that a similar effort with the next legislature will bring us success. In regard to this matter the chairman of the building committee speaks more fully.

A SHAKESPEARE GARDEN.
So wide an interest in the commemoration of the tercentennial celebration of Shakespeare's death has been awakened by the "Drama League of America" that there will be many old English gardens planted in 1916,--gardens containing as many as possible of those flowers mentioned in his plays.
Not all of these many flowers and shrubs could be grown in our climate, some mentioned, such as nettles, burdocks, plantains and other weeds, would be entirely out of place in a garden, soon overrunning it. It must be remembered, too, that in Shakespeare's time herbs and wild flowers were cultivated in most gardens, that many considered beautiful then are now almost forgotten, and that some have been so far surpassed by their improved hybrids, the originals would not now be cultivated.
We have not attempted, therefore, to include all of the flowers so lovingly mentioned by the poet, but have used only those that will prove beautiful and hardy in Minnesota, making a planting that will prove, with proper care, permanent. Were each plant labeled with its proper quotation the garden would prove much more interesting, e.g., "There's rosemary, that's for remembrance--" Hamlet, marking the plant of that name.
_Annuals._--Gillyflowers (Ten weeks' stocks); Love in Idleness (Pansy, Viola tricolor); Mallow (Lavatera splendens); Marigold (Calendula officinalis); Poppy (Somniferum, Opium poppy).
_Trees._--Hemlock, Hawthorne.
_Vines._--Honeysuckle, Scarlet Trumpet.
_Bulbs._--Scilla Nutans (Hyacinthus nonscriptus); Daffodils; Saffron (Crocus santious); Crown Imperial (Frittilaria Imperialis); Lily, Candidum, Turk's Cap (Scarlet Martagon), Orange Lily (Croseum), Spectabile, Tigrinum.
_Herbs._--Balm (Lemon Balm); Camomile (Anthemis); Caraway; Dian's Bud (Wormwood, Artemisia Absinthium); Fennel (Foeniculum officinalis); Hyssop (Hyssopus officinalis); Lavender (Lavendula vera); Marjoram (Origanum vulgare); Mint; Milfoil (Yarrow); Parsley; Rosemary (Rosmarinus officinalis); Rue (Ruta graveoleons); Savory; Thyme (1, Thymus vulgaris, 2, Thymus Serpyllum).
_Perennials._--Aconite (Napellus); Balm (Bee-balm); Brake; Carnation (Bizarre Dianthus caryophyllus); Clover (Crimson Trifolium incarnatus); Columbine (Aquilegia vulgaris); Cowslip (Primula veris); Crowflower (Ragged Robin, Lychnis floscuculi); Cuckoo Buds (Butter cups, Ranunculus acris); Daisies (Bellis perennis); Eryngium M. (Sea Holly); Flax; Flower de luce (Iris Germanica, blue); Fumitory (Dicentra spectabilis; Bleeding Heart); Harebell (Campanula rotundifolia); Larksheel (Delphinium elatum, Bee Larkspur); Peony; Pinks (Dianthus Plumarius); Violet (Viola Odorata).
_Roses._--Brier (Eglantine Rose), Provencal (Cabbage Rose), Musk, Damask, White Provence, York and Lancaster.
For appropriate quotations to mark each flower the little book, "Shakespeare's Garden," by J.H. Bloom, will be found very helpful. Our other authorities have been Biesley and L. Grindon, all of which are in the Public Library.

SUGGESTIONS TO PARTIES PLANNING TO PURCHASE NURSERY STOCK.
It may be quite out of place to offer any suggestions along this line to readers of this magazine, and yet some buyers may find help in the following:
For evident reasons it pays to buy Minnesota stock where possible, stock which has been tried out and found to be hardy, rather than purchase new varieties, glowingly described in catalogues. Always buy from an inspected nursery.
For evident reasons it pays to buy from nurseries near at hand, so that the time elapsing from the shipping of the trees or shrubs and the planting is small.
Further, it is always desirable, if possible, to buy from the nurseryman himself, a responsible party, rather than from an agent. It is further very desirable to personally pick out your own stock in a visit to the nursery.
When the goods are received, see that they bear an inspection certificate for the current year. The plants should be in good condition and show that the roots are protected from air and wrapped in moist packing material. The condition of the received goods indicates the carefulness of the nurseryman or the contrary. Do not allow trees or shrubs to lie neglected after being received, where the roots will dry out. If you are not ready to plant they should be at once heeled in, first divesting them of their wrappings.
If any injurious insects, like scales or fungus-looking growths, are found on the trees, the same should be reported to the Experiment Station. After planting the trees and shrubs, they should receive the best of care in regard to cultivation.
Finally, refuse to accept any raspberry or blackberry plants showing crown gall on roots or crowns.

CROWN GALL ON RASPBERRIES BLACKBERRIES.
All the nurserymen are able to recognize crown gall, and whatever we may think regarding its effect or lack of effect upon apple, we know by personal observation that it may and does cause the death of raspberries. This disease of course is, unfortunately, very common--almost universally present in our nurseries. The public, generally, are so well aware of its injurious effect upon canes that they are indignant when any such stock is received from nurseries. It behooves all nurserymen, therefore, for the sake of their own business interests if nothing else, to be extremely careful that no diseased stock of any kind is sent to patrons.
* * * * *
THE DESTRUCTION OF A CARLOAD OF DISEASED POTATOES.
The State Entomologist, by virtue of being a collaborator with and agent for the United States Horticultural Board, supervised the destruction by burning of 403 sacks of potatoes, seven per cent. of which, according to the testimony of our Plant Pathology Division, were infested with powdery scab. The Great Northern Railroad, which had brought the potatoes from Canada, were given the choice by Federal authorities, either to return the potatoes to Canada or destroy them by burning, under our supervision. They chose the latter procedure and the use of the Minneapolis crematory was secured for this purpose. Ninety sacks of this same shipment which were illegally unloaded at Casselton, N. Dak., were buried by North Dakota authorities. It is to be hoped that this disease does not find its way into the potato belt in the Red River Valley.
NOTES ON PLANT PESTS.
Prepared by Section of Insect Pests, A. G. RUGGLES, and by Section of Plant Diseases, E. C. STAKMAN, University Farm.
The first real spraying of the apple orchard should be given just as the center bud of the flower cluster begins to show pink. The material to use in the spraying compound is lime-sulphur (1 to 40) plus arsenate of lead, 1-1/2 pounds of the powder, or three pounds of the arsenate of paste to fifty gallons of the made-up lime-sulphur. If done properly this will get the scab of the apple, blossom blight or the brown rot in the plum, and is the most important spray for plum pocket. The arsenate of lead in the mixture will control the young of leaf eating insects and precocious plum curculios.
The second most important spraying of the year is given within a week after the blossoms fall, the same spraying compound being used. This spraying kills many of the germinating spores of such things as apple scab and also is the important spray for codling worm as well as for the plum curculio and for leaf eating insects.
Watch carefully for the hatching of plant lice eggs. The ideal time to spray for these is just after hatching, and before the young lice become hidden in the bud scales or in the curl of the leaves. The spraying material to use at this time is a sulphate of nicotine.
Plow the plum orchard as soon as possible in order to turn under mummied plums, which are responsible for much of the primary infection of brown rot.
Plowing the apple orchard early to turn under the old leaves is also essential in preventing scab spreading to the flower stalks.
Cultivate the vineyard in order to turn under the mummies. Practice clean cultivation from the very beginning in order to help control black rot and downy mildew. If the rot or mildew was very bad in the previous years, early spraying with the Bordeaux mixture 4-4-50 is very important.
Keep the radishes, cauliflowers, and cabbages covered with a poison spray from April 30 to May 20 to prevent the ravages of the cabbage maggot. This should be applied once a week in fair weather, and twice a week in rainy weather. The spray is made as follows:
Lead arsenate, three-fourths ounce; New Orleans molasses, one-half pint; water, one gallon.
Look over the seedling cabbages carefully and destroy all which show any sign of wilting or rotting.
Cut out apple twigs badly injured by the buffalo tree hopper and burn them immediately.
Watch for plant lice on lettuce in cold frames. To combat the insects the plants should be sprayed with nicofume liquid, one teaspoonful to a gallon of water.
BEE-KEEPER'S COLUMN
Conducted by FRANCIS JAGER, Professor of Apiculture, University Farm, St. Paul.
COMB HONEY, EXTRACTED HONEY, AND INCREASE.
The practical beekeeper must decide at the beginning of the honey season whether he wishes to produce extracted honey, comb honey or merely to increase the number of his colonies. The manner of management of his apiary will depend upon such decision. At any rate a modern outfit, pure bred colonies in modern ten or eight frame hives, is required for successful beekeeping no matter in what line of bee industry he may feel inclined to engage.
For production of extracted honey the ten frame hive is to be preferred. Bees are less inclined to swarm in a ten frame hive, and two ten frame supers as a rule will be required where three eight frame supers would otherwise be necessary.
In successful extracted honey production swarming may be reduced to a minimum if during the dandelion and fruit trees honey flow, and in the beginning of white clover flow, once a week an empty drawn comb be inserted into the middle of the brood nest. As soon as the brood chamber has eight frames of brood the queen excluder is added and an extracting super added filled with white extracting combs. If the beekeeper does not care to raise his extracted honey in snow white combs only, the excluder may be omitted, but the result will be that the queen will lay eggs throughout the whole hive, thus rendering extracting difficult on account of brood present. When raising extracted honey on a large scale two extracting supers may suffice for each colony. When the one next to the brood chamber is filled it is extracted at once, the top one taking its place next to the brood. The extracted super when empty is then given back to the bees and placed on top. When the second super is filled the process is repeated. This process of extracting honey requires a period of four or five weeks. All supers are removed at the end of the honey flow. The last full super, however, should not be extracted but saved for the feeding of light colonies in the fall and spring.
The easier way to produce extracted honey is to have enough supers, say three or four for each colony. The first is added during the dandelion or fruit blossom flow as soon as the colony is strong enough to readily enter into it. When this super is nearly full and the combs can be seen through the top bars to whiten, another super is added next to the brood chamber, and the partly filled super is raised. When this second super begins to get well filled, a third and a fourth super is added on top. In the latitude of Minneapolis it is not advisable to insert a super next to brood chambers after July 4th, or two weeks before the end of the honey flow, because such procedure would result in a large amount of uncapped honey.
Comb honey should not be produced where the honey flow is slow and intermittent. Weak colonies will not produce comb honey profitably. In making up supers only A 1 sections should be used, with full sheets of extra thin foundation and three-eighths inch bottom starters of thin foundation. Care should be taken to fasten the foundation very solidly, else heat and weight of bees will cause it to drop. One or more bait sections should be used in the first comb honey super to induce the bees to enter into it more readily. Bait sections are the half finished, unmarketable sections of the previous season. One to four are used near the center of each super.

The State Flower and State Flag of Minnesota.
E. A. SMITH, VICE PRES. JEWELL NURS. CO., LAKE CITY.
The material in this paper has been gathered from several sources, part of which has never before been published. It is presented not so much in the spirit of criticism as it is in the spirit of making the best of a mistake which the writer believes occurred when the moccasin flower was designated as the state flower of Minnesota.
Last spring an acquaintance of mine was rambling through the woods and came across the Cypripedium, or the Moccasin flower, or the Lady slipper, the state flower of Minnesota. He sent me a few specimens. Although I had lived in the state of Minnesota for a number of years, this was the first time that I had ever seen the state flower or known anything about it. The incident set me to thinking, and I went to work to find out what I could about this flower. I herewith present that information as briefly as possible.
There are forty-one states in the Union that have a state flower. Other states have the matter under consideration. This fact alone would indicate that a state flower is of some importance as an emblem, or it would not be so generally considered by the various states. In most instances the flower was selected by a vote of the public school scholars of the respective states. The vote was then submitted to the state legislature and a resolution adopted making the state flower legal. I submit to you the question: Are school children qualified to choose a flower as an emblem of the state? Do they understand the conditions required in the state and the purpose of the selection sufficiently well to enable them to select intelligently? Do the children in your school know what flower is common in the northern part of the state as well as in the southern part of the state?
In Minnesota, however, the state flower was not chosen by the school children of the state, but upon petition of the Woman's Auxiliary Board of World's Fair Managers a resolution was introduced into the senate February 4th, 1893, by the late Senator W.B. Dean, providing that the wild Lady Slipper, or the Moccasin flower, Cypripedium calceolus, be accepted and the same designated and adopted as the state flower, or the floral emblem of the state of Minnesota. This resolution was also adopted in the house the same day. A few years later upon petition of the Nature Club of Minneapolis the variety was changed to the Reginae or Spectabile, variety.
The mystery of the selection in this state is, why was a flower chosen which is not common to any part of the state? We therefore have a state flower, beautiful in itself, but without special appeal to the people because it is comparatively unknown.
There are about forty species of the Cypripedium belonging to the north temperate zone. Several of these species occur in the northern United States and Canada, east of the Rocky Mountains, which are found in the state of Minnesota. It is called the Moccasin flower because it resembles the Indian shoe. This plant grows preferably in cool and moist woods or in bogs. It flowers principally during the months of May and June. The varieties differ in color, being deep red, pink, yellow, white and variegated. All of the species, however, are very beautiful.
The varieties more commonly found in Minnesota are, Acaule, rose purple; Candidum, small white; Arietinum, red and white; Parviflorum, small yellow; Pubescens, large yellow; and Spectabile, description of which is as follows: Plants stout, leaves oval, acute; sepals, roundish, white; petals, oblong, white; labellum, white or pale pink purple. Very showy.
It is unfortunate that the Minnesota State Flower does not take kindly to civilization and cultivation, as it is very difficult to transplant. About ten years ago at Lake City, Minnesota, we tried to propagate the moccasin flower. We dug the roots and transplanted them in ground especially prepared in a nearby grove where we could watch their development, but the plants were a failure.
A state flower should be one of the common flowers of the state, so familiar to all, that its name would suggest a picture of the flower itself. Probably not 10 per cent of the people of the state have ever seen it. On this account it is to be regretted that this variety was chosen as the flower emblem of the state. A state flower, like the state flag, should be accessible and familiar to everyone, and yet, probably, the state flag of Minnesota is a stranger to many residents of the state, for Minnesota did not have a state flag until 1893.
An emblem should mean something to the individual. The family coat of arms and the iron cross are distinctive emblems. The shamrock in sentiment is as dear to an Irishman as his native land. If an emblem means something to the individual, how much more it ought to mean to the state and nation.
The flag is an emblem of loyalty and patriotism. Men fight for it. They lay down their lives for it because it stands for home and country. I fancy if men did not know what the flag looked like, the fight would not be a very fierce one. Do you know what the state flag of Minnesota looks like? A description of it can be found in the Legislative Manual for 1915. This flag bears a wreath of white moccasin flowers (Spectabile) upon a blue background, in the center of which is the state seal. The design was chosen by a committee of six ladies. It is appropriate and beautiful, and was designed by Mrs. Edward H. Center, of Minneapolis.
The state should furnish an attractive picture of the state flower and the state flag to every high school in the state, free of charge. The influence would be good, creating a deeper loyalty to the state.

Having now disposed of the usual compliments befitting the occasion I will aim to tell you of a few things we are trying to do in the Wisconsin society.
The efforts of our society during the past ten years have been directed quite largely to the development of commercial fruit-growing in the state. While we have not overlooked nor forgotten the home owner we have been working to take commercial orcharding out of the hands of the farmer and put it in the hands of specialists, and we are succeeding. We have today about thirty thousand acres of purely commercial orchards in Wisconsin and more coming. We discourage by every means at command the planting of fruit trees by the man who is engaged in general farming except sufficient for his own use.
Further, in this campaign we aim to concentrate our efforts on certain districts so as to build up fruit centers. For instance we have in Door County, that narrow little neck of land between Green Bay and Lake Michigan, over seven thousand five hundred acres of orchards, apple and cherry.
Along the Bayfield shore line we have another splendid fruit district almost, if not quite, as well known as Hood River and worth vastly more.
In the southwestern corner of the state along the valley of the Kickapoo River, on the high bluffs on either side of the river, have been planted a thousand acres of apples and cherries in the past five years.
While not all of this development is directly due to the Horticultural Society, ours has been the moving spirit. The Kickapoo development is due wholly to the work of the society.
In this way we are establishing an industry that will be a tremendous asset to the state. There was a time when dairying was but a feeble industry in Wisconsin, and now we lead.
Our society also aids in the development of marketing associations. In doing these things we also aid the farmer and home owner, for whatever is best in the commercial orchard is best in the home orchard. Spraying, pruning and cultivation as practiced by the expert serve as models for the farmer who has but two dozen trees.

Marketing Fruit Direct.
H. G. STREET, HEBRON, ILL.
In studying this subject, the direct marketing of fruit, let us first see how much it includes. Does it include simply marketing alone? Or does the success of it depend principally upon the varieties of fruit set out together with the after cultivation, pruning and spraying? First of all you must interest people in your work by producing something that they really want, and half of your problem will then be solved.
There are any number of places in the northwest where the demand far exceeds the supply. I do not mean for the common run of fruit full of worms and covered with scab, but, instead, strictly No. 1 fruit of the very best varieties.
About 1901, through the advice of my uncle, Dr. A. H. Street, of Albert Lea, I joined your society, and through the experience of your members I learned many valuable lessons. Perhaps the one that impressed me the most was that of grafting our choicest varieties upon hardy crab stocks so as to make them hardy enough to withstand our hardest winters, and by so doing it nearly insures us against total failures in the fruit crop and especially against losing the trees outright.
This top-working of course will not do all; we still have to assist Nature by proper spraying, pruning, cultivating, etc. Doing all in your power to secure a crop each year to supply the trade you have already worked up is a big item in holding it.
While studying your conditions, together with those of Wisconsin and Illinois, I became very much interested in the native plums as well as in the apple industry. Therefore I also set out some three acres of the following varieties: Surprise, Terry, Wyant, Hammer and Hawkeye, also some of the Emerald and Lombard.
As this was then new business to me, I had fallen into no deep ruts, and of course I took it for granted that all horticulturists practiced what they preached. Therefore I pruned, sprayed, etc., according to directions, and in due time the fruits of my labor commenced to show up, and they certainly were attractive to the eye as well as to the taste.
As our supply increased our demand increased also, so that for the past five years our average plum crop has been around 2,000 baskets (the 8-lb. grape basket) and all sold readily at 25 to 35 cents retail.
We are located at Hebron, Illinois, eight miles south of Lake Geneva, Wis., on the Chicago & Lake Geneva Railway, which makes an ideal location for a fancy trade. During plum harvest it is nothing uncommon to have fifty to 100 visitors a day. These customers include all classes, from the Chicago millionaires to the common laborers, and all receive the same cordial reception.
We make it a point never to allow them to think that we are close with our fruit--not even the neighborhood boys, as they are our best friends. What they buy we charge them a good fair price for and never fail to give all new customers a few choice samples of best varieties.
By the latter part of the plum season our big red Wolf River apples commence to show up and cook well; also Wealthy and McIntosh commence to get ripe enough to eat, and the demand each year has far exceeded the supply.
So far we have had very few poor apples, but we always sort them into three grades, the third grade being made up into cider to sell while sweet. The second grade we sell as such for immediate use. The firsts of the McIntosh we have sold at $2.00 to $2.50 per bushel, Wealthy, Jonathan and Grimes at $1.50 to $2.00, while Wolf, N. W. Greening, Salome, Winesap, Milwaukee, etc., have averaged us $1.25 per bushel. We are always very careful not to have any bruised, diseased or ill shaped specimens in our first grade.
The President: Can you tell us something more about your experience in marketing direct? Do you sell all the fruit you raise on the place?
Mr. Street: We sell about all the fruit that we raise direct to the consumer. When we first started we started with strawberries, and about half of our crop went to the merchants, and he would retail it for 20 per cent, but to any one that came there for it we would charge the full retail price, same as he had to charge, and we never had any trouble with any of the stores that we dealt with. If we have any seconds or anything we don't like to put out to the stores we sell them to our customers and charge them whatever we think would be right for them.
As to plums, about two-thirds of those would sell right direct to customers coming there, the rest we supplied to the stores at 20 per cent discount so that they could retail them at the same price that we retail them for. Since the apples have begun to bear it seems that two-thirds of the people want the McIntosh, and almost everyone is satisfied with its flavor. They average a little larger with us than the Wealthy, and some of them you can hardly tell from the Wealthy unless you know just about what the fruit is. Last year we kept them until about February or possibly later, but an apple with as good a flavor as that you cannot keep from being eaten up.
The President: I suppose that is automobile trade?
Mr. Street: A great deal of it is.
The President: How did you get it? By advertising?
Mr. Street: No, by doing something so much different from what anybody else is doing you get people to talking. I think the Wolf River apple together with the Terry and Surprise plums have been the cause of getting started. Of course, the McIntosh now is helping out, too. You give a person a few Wolf River, not for eating but for cooking, and then give him a Wealthy or something like that to eat--they will be looking at the big Wolf River and eating the other and seem to be well satisfied and always come back. Whenever we sell to the stores we always gauge our prices so that the majority of their customers will take our fruit before taking the shipped in fruit from Chicago. We find with grapes we can charge about five cents a basket more than they retail the Michigan grapes for.
For native plums we get more than they do for the Michigan fruit. We have had quite a good many of the Burbank plums, but we cannot sell over one-third as many as we do of the natives.
A Member: You don't ship them, so don't consider the packing?
Mr. Street: The only ones we ship are those ordered by people coming there or by letter. If they want a bushel we pack them in a bushel box. If they want three or six bushels then we pack them in barrels.
Mr. Anderson: Where are you located?
Mr. Street: Just south of the Wisconsin state line.
Mr. Anderson: I am located 100 miles west of here, and I shipped out 400 bushels of apples to the Dakotas last year direct.
Mr. Richardson: How many growers are there in your neighborhood growing fruit commercially?
Mr. Street: I do not know of any who spray, cultivate and prune according to the best methods within about 100 miles. We always make it a point to give our customers good fruit, so that we are not afraid to recommend it. Then there is another advantage. If they come right there, and we have any seconds we can tell them just what they are, and if they want them we can sell them for what they are worth, but if we are putting them into a store, I prefer not to put in seconds.
Mr. Kochendorfer: I think that is the advantage of disposing on a public market. You have a chance to sell the inferior goods without any coming back.
Mr. Street: The main thing is to use improved methods and try to outdo the other fellow. Cultivate a little more thoroughly, put in your cover crop, not over-fertilize but all you possibly can; give the dormant spray; spray before bloom very thoroughly and again after bloom; two weeks after that again, about July 15th.
Mr. Richardson: How many apple trees have you?
Mr. Street: We now have ten acres in apples, but most of them are young, about three acres in bearing.
Mr. Richardson: I would like to ask the gentleman if in a small place that way he hasn't a better local market than we have here in the larger cities. Around Lake Minnetonka they raise grapes, but we get most of our grapes from Ohio and Indiana. I have wondered why it is that these grapes go to another market when they can just as well go to the Minneapolis market. You know as well as I do anyone buying fruit in the Twin Cities always buy fruit grown in Ohio or Indiana.
Mr. Street: I do not know why it is, but so far we haven't realized that we have any competition. We charge for our best eating apples fully as much as the stores have to charge for the Western fancy packed fruit. There is not a worm hole or speck of disease on the No. 1, and really I can't see how they can compete after raising the fruit in the West and packing and shipping it to Chicago and then out there. The price they would have to charge there would make us a good fair price; in fact, a good big price.
A Satisfactory Marketing System.
G. A. ANDERSON, RENVILLE.
I have marketed this fall some over 400 barrels of apples, mostly Wealthy, Duchess and Northwestern Greening. Three hundred barrels of these were shipped direct to local merchants in Dakota and western Minnesota towns in small shipments of a few barrels at a time or as fast as they could sell them. I started this way of marketing during the big crop of 1913 and this year again, getting nearly all of my old customers back and many new ones. I secured satisfactory prices, and for my location I believe I have solved the marketing problem. One does not pay much attention to the marketing as long as enough only for local demand is produced, but when one has a surplus to dispose of the marketing problem looms rather large. I have tried several times shipping to commission firms, but have never received satisfactory returns.
A Successful Cold Storage for Apples.
H. F. HANSEN, ORCHARDIST, ALBERT LEA.
Mr. Clarence Wedge: I want to preface this short paper with the statement that Mr. Hansen is a man who has worked himself up from the very bottom of the horticultural ladder. He came to Albert Lea a very poor man, and I think supported himself for some time by trapping and fishing and such work as he was able to do. He is a man with a great tendency to investigate and to work out problems for himself. By his thrift and persevering investigations he has brought himself into a fine property and great success. He is the market gardener in our part of the country and a credit to his kind. (Mr. Wedge reads the paper.)
When my orchard, near the city of Albert Lea, began to bear heavy crops of fruit, I found it very desirable to hold the Wealthy and other kinds that ripen at the same time until after the farmers had marketed their fruit. We have a very good cold storage in Albert Lea that is open to the public, but the price they charge is sixty cents per barrel for two months' storage, which is more than the fruit will bear, and so I began to think of putting up a cold storage of my own.
My first one was built underground with pipes for ice and salt to cool it, something like the system that I am now using. But I found out in the first season that it takes a great deal of ice to offset the heat that is coming in from the ground at the sides and bottom of the cellar. And so I built the storage which I am now using entirely above ground, using the basement under it for storing cabbage and vegetables. I built this in 1913, the size 28x56 feet, using cement blocks for the basement, where the cabbages are stored. The cold storage above this is built as follows:
First, an ordinary frame building with 2x4 inch studdings sheathed on the outside with drop siding with No. 3 flooring. Inside of this sheathing 2x4 inch studs placed flatwise, sheathed on the inside with No. 3 flooring, and the six-inch space back of the studs filled with sawdust. On the outside of this firing strips one-half foot are nailed, which are covered with linofelt. One-half foot firing strips are nailed inside of this, and these also covered with linofelt. To this again one-half foot firing strips are added, to which are nailed metal lath, and the whole is plastered with cement. The floor both above and below is made of 2×12 joists, with No. 3 flooring nailed below the joints, the space between which is then filled with ten inches of saw dust, leaving an air space of two inches at the upper edge of the joists. The joists are then covered with linofelt and then the linofelt covered with No. 3 flooring.
On the north and west sides I found it necessary to add one more waterproof coat of linofelt in order to make sure of keeping out the frost.
I have so far only finished up for cold storage one-half of the room, using the other half for a packing room, so that my present facilities are only 28×28 feet. This room is cooled by eight inch pipes of galvanized iron, extending from the attic above to troughs near the floor, that are sloping so as to carry off the melted ice. These pipes are on both sides about two feet apart. The ice is pulled up into the attic by horsepower and broken up small enough into pieces to feed the pipes. The amount of salt used with the ice depends upon how fast we want the ice to melt. A large quantity of salt cools the storage down quicker. In practice I find that it takes one hour for a man to elevate a ton of ice, chop it up and fill the pipes. They hold something over a ton and must be filled every other day in ordinary September weather. It will not do to let the pipes remain less than one-half full. When the ice gets down that far, we have to fill again.
The total cost of my storage when it is entirely furnished up and the present capacity doubled will be about $3,000.00. At present it holds 2,000 standard size apple boxes.
I find that it only pays to put in good fruit that in ordinary seasons will keep until the first of March and hold its flavor well and give good satisfaction on the market. Icing stops about the middle of November. The cost per box for storage is as follows: Ice and salt, ten cents. Interest on investment, six cents. I have figured out carefully the entire cost of growing and storing apples, and find out that leaving out the interest on the value of the land, it will approximate forty-eight cents per bushel. This includes cultivation, spraying, packing, and picking. The question which now interests me is whether we can grow fruit good enough and stand the expense and compete with apples grown in the other good fruit sections of the country.
Mr. Older: I had the pleasure of visiting this plant with Mr. Wedge, and this man had quite a good many boxes of as fine apples as you would wish to see. This was along the latter part of February, and they were in fine condition. He had a lot of Jonathans and Yankees and some other varieties I don't remember, grown on top-worked trees there.
The Plum Curculio.
EDWARD A. NELSON, UNIVERSITY FARM, ST. PAUL.
(Prize Winner at Gideon Memorial Contest.)
The small crescent-shaped punctures, so common on apples, plums, peaches and other fruits, are made by a small snout-beetle known as the plum curculio. The beetles issue from their winter quarters at about the time the trees are in full bloom and feed on the tender foliage, buds and blossoms. Later they attack the newly set fruit, cutting small circular holes through the skin in feeding, while the females, in the operation of egg-laying, make the crescentic cuts so characteristic of this species. The egg, deposited under the skin of the fruit, soon hatches into a very small whitish larva or grub, which makes its way into the flesh of the fruit. Here it feeds greedily and grows rapidly, becoming, in the course of two weeks, the fat, dirty white "worm" so well known among fruit growers.
The curculio is a native of North America and for more than 150 years has been known as an enemy of fruits. Our early horticultural literature abounds with reference to its depredations. In more recent times the great increase in planting of fruits, brought about to supply the increased demand, has permitted it to become much more abundant than formerly, and the plum curculio constitutes at the present time one of the most serious insect enemies of orchard fruits. Statistics gathered of its depredations show that it is distributed over much of the area of the United States. Its western limit is, roughly, a line drawn through the centers of North Dakota, South Dakota, Nebraska, Kansas, Oklahoma and Texas. East of this line the entire United States is infested except the southern third of Florida and the northern half of Maine.
Is the plum curculio causing much damage to the fruit growing industry of this country? That it is is shown by the National Conservation Committee in its report in Volume III, page 309, where it states that the average annual loss in late years to only three fruits is as follows:
Apples $3,257,806
Peaches 4,088,814
Plums 1,244,149 ---------- Grand Total $8,590,769
Just think of it! A total loss each year to only three fruits of over $8,500,000. This amount is a heavy drain upon the fruit growing industry of this country. During the past twenty-five or thirty years the total damage caused by this insect, to the various fruits which it attacks, would, on a conservative estimate, probably be not less than $100,000,000.
These figures show the absolute need of the adoption of effective remedial measures against this insect so as to lessen this loss. But before we can hope to combat this insect systematically and successfully it is necessary to know its life history and habits.
There are four distinct stages in its life cycle: (1) The egg, (2) the larva, or "worm," (3) the pupa, and (4) the adult, or beetle.
The curculio passes the winter in the adult stage under accumulations of partly decayed leaves, among the closely-packed dried grass of sod-covered orchards, and probably wherever suitable protection from the winter may be found. Its depredations are usually worse near woods, so it probably finds here very suitable places for wintering.
